So, what is Qi or Qi charging, and really, most of us have probably been using this technology for years, and just aren't aware of it, with our wireless toothbrushes. So, if anybody has a Sonicare, or a competing wireless toothbrush, you've already been using this technology. Basically, you have your transmitting device, which is your charging base, and that's your corded charger, and historically, you've been plugging, or resting your toothbrush back into that base, and that's recharging, and that toothbrush, then, is the receiver. So, you've got a coil in your transmitting device, which is your charging base, and a coil in your receiver, and when those two things are aligned, and within a several-millimeter distance of each other, this electromagnetic induction occurs, and you recharge your battery. So, now, most smartphones are compatible with this technology. So, you've got the receiver in your phone, and it's embedded in your phone, and your transmitting device, and that's what we're selling now, are the transmitters, or the Qi charging bases. So, that's very simple, if you just put it in the context of your toothbrush. It's a great way to think about it. So, smartphones with wireless charging capabilities have been around since about 2012, but really it was in late 2017, November of 2017, when Apple released the iPhone 8 and X that this really became commonplace in the market, and that coincides, really, with when just a few months after that release, is when iClick really joined this market, and released our first series of Qi wireless charging, so we've got this market penetration and saturation now, where we're seeing this critical mass of smartphones in the market that are Qi-compatible, and that's really what's driving the sales in this category. In the old days, when we first, when I say old days, I'm old enough to know when cell phones first came out, and what they told you to do is use it all day long, run your battery down to zero, and then go home and recharge it at night. Well, the batteries now, that's actually the opposite of what you wanna do. Your battery only has 500 to 600 full cycles before it's essentially fried, so if you took that approach now with your smartphone, your phone would last you about a year and a half, and you'd be completely done. So, optimally, you wanna keep your battery between 30 to 40 and 80% charged at all times. Okay, so what we say is ABC, always be charging. So, for the optimal health and life of your battery, you wanna be grabbing those quick charges. You wanna be getting at that additional 10, 15% boost, keeping your battery between that 40 to 60, or 40 to 80% charged at all times. In fact, even if you leave your phone on a charger overnight, once you reach 100, that's actually not optimal, because you continue to draw down, and ping back up, and draw down, and ping back up, which is wearing on your battery, so optimally, you wanna keep between 40 and 80%, and so as we've designed this line that we're gonna talk about of Qi chargers, we really had that thought in mind. One term that you hear in the market, and that comes up quite a bit, is Qi certification, and this is really the Wireless Power Consortium's moniker in what they deem quality, and certified in the marketplace, but what it really does is enable you to use this logo. So, you pay a fee, and you go through some testing, and then you're able to use this Qi-Certified logo. What's really important to know is that FCC certification is the industry standard for certified product in this space, and we go through rigorous testing. What this ensures is that you have foreign-object detection. Obviously, the coils aren't gonna heat up, and catch fire, and those types of things, so all of our product line is FCC-certified in this space, and that's really the certification you wanna look for. It really comes down to the distance that you have between your device, and the wireless charger, so a classic, plastic PopSocket can work, but it depends. Once you start adding layers, like cases, and that kind of a thing, you can reach a gap that's too far for the wireless charger to work.
